Handover for Matchpoint GC work: we traced the matching service's pause spikes to old-gen promotion during bulk candidate loads, not the heap size itself. I've tuned the collector to favor shorter pauses and capped the batch size upstream; both changes are load-tested. Please keep these in sync if you retune. The service currently runs with the following settings.

config for tajof-kawep:
[aldius]
port = 3000
region = lower-2
host = aldius.plorvasoft.example
team = eliius
timeout_ms = 750
retries = 6

Handover Note — Retail Pilot

To: S. Varley. From: E. Dunmore.

The Copperfield Stores pilot is live in eight locations. Weekly sell-through reports go to the sales leads each Monday. Renewal discussion is scheduled for the sixth week. Pricing remains provisional. For the commercial direction behind this pilot, see the confidential note below.

management briefing: Project Ulavan slips by two quarters because of the staffing delay.

## Onboarding: Resetly flow revamp

The Harborlight password reset flow now issues one-time links through the Resetly service instead of emailing raw tokens. Link payloads are signed server-side and verified at redemption. For local testing, run the reset worker with the staging environment enabled and verify redemption succeeds end to end. Configure your local worker with the staging signing key below.

rollout seal: bky4_sSmA

Facilities ticket — Halewick Tower, night shift.

Issue: support team reporting east stairwell reader rejecting badges after midnight. Reader was reset this morning; firmware updated. Overnight crew should now badge as normal. If the reader fails again, use the manual keypad by the fire door — do not prop the door. Log any further failures with the time and badge name. Temporary keypad code for the fallback door is below.

door code, tajeg-fawip: bdg-K-62